Major Donation Transforms Purdue's Construction Education Program

Purdue University has announced a significant transformation in its construction education program following a generous $10 million donation from the Bowen family. As a result of this investment, the School of Construction Management Technology will be renamed the Bowen School of Construction. This change is expected to have a profound impact on the quality and scope of construction education at Purdue.

The funding will not only enhance the educational offerings but will also focus on strengthening partnerships with industry leaders. This initiative aims to better prepare students for the evolving demands of the construction sector. Additionally, the investment is set to stimulate growth in both Indianapolis and West Lafayette, fostering a more robust workforce in the region.

With this strategic move, Purdue is positioning itself as a leader in construction education, ensuring that students receive top-notch training and resources to excel in their careers. The Bowen family's commitment to education and industry advancement is set to reshape the future of construction management at Purdue.
